The Zeiger Homestead is back. Last night the wind rose to steady northerly, and charged our battery bank to 100%. This morning we’ve got lights on, we’re playing the radio (instead of a battery powered boom box, which we’d relied on all week) and we’re charging recyclable batteries as fast as we can. Michelle is working from home via computer. Life is returning to normal.

We weathered another period of Low Power. Now, as seems typical, we’ve put the brake on the wind generator before a northerly gale develops later this afternoon. We don’t expect much sunshine, so we’ll need to turn it back on after the gale passes.
